About the Game

A skill game where players vote for the best actresses, actors, directors, movies and songs. Players draw action cards and decide to use or hold card. There is no hand size limit. Used cards are returned to the bottom the pile. Players then roll a steel ball down the runway twice- first to determine which candidate, the second to determine the cost of the candidate. After two or more players have a candidate in the same category, one of those players may call for a vote when playing a "Contest" action card. Vote cards are drawn until a player decides to stand, but beware drawing the "Loser" card that puts you out of the contest immediately. At this point, all players reveal the vote cards they have just drawn and the high vote getter wins a Hollywood Award. The winner is the first player to get 3 Hollywood Awards.
